Exmor is the name of a technology Sony implemented on some of their CMOS image sensors. The Sony Ericsson Xperia acro is an Android smartphone produced by Sony Ericsson Mobile Communications in Japan.

Back-illuminated sensor

A back-illuminated sensor, also known as backside illumination (BSI or BI) sensor, is a type of digital image sensor that uses a novel arrangement of the imaging elements to increase the amount of light captured and thereby improve low-light performance.

Sony Ericsson Xperia arc

The Sony Ericsson Xperia arc is an Android smartphone launched on 24 March 2011 in Japan, and 1 April 2011 in Europe.

Sony Xperia acro S

The Sony Xperia acro S (known as the Sony Xperia acro HD in Japan) is a dust- and water-resistant Android smartphone produced and developed by Sony Mobile Communications.
